Transaction 59207355bf9530a976e44a427f90c6a866c8bd0353a9cf90701a7399c54e0255
1 Input
1 Output
-
59207355bf9530a976e44a427f90c6a866c8bd0353a9cf90701a7399c54e0255:0
- value
- 611693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1ef64e693638b8a398f8041a4023688c1f8f7c0 OP_EQUAL
- address
- 3Lq3w2sEh67MuVtn2Bk5gagET8CnHgW8P2